Introduction

The duochrome test is a more comprehensive and traditional test to identify potential refractive errors and visual acuity. This test has straightforward procedures and helps to improve eye health. This article elaborates on the duochrome test, its advantages, and limitations.

What Is a Duochrome Test?

The duochrome test is an eye examination that is used to identify visual acuity and refractive errors. It is also known as the red-green test. This test is done by giving the individuals a chart that contains letters or numbers in contrasting green and red colors. The individuals are asked to read the letters or numbers and say the dominant color they see. This assessment helps eye care professionals to identify refractive errors that cause conditions like myopia, hyperopia, and emmetropia. This test helps individuals have a faster need for corrective glasses or lenses.

What Is the Principle of the Duochrome Test?

The duochrome test works on the principle of the differential focusing ability of the eye to different wavelengths of light. Incorporating the red and green contrasting colors this test works on the fact that the eye focuses on these contracted colors differently. The basic phenomenon of this test is that it depends on the refractive state of the eye, which may focus on one color over the other. These different focuses help in the identification of refractive errors.

What Are the Procedures for Duochrome Tests?

The duochrome test involves straightforward procedures. The procedures include

  • Color Selection: This test usually needs the contrast red and green color. It needs a chart with letters and numbers in red and green color.

  • Distance: The individuals should be positioned 6 meters (20 feet) from the chart.

  • Reading the Chart: The individuals are asked to read the numbers and letters on the chart by focusing on their sharpness and clarity.

  • Subjective Assessment: After reading the chart, the individuals are asked to express their preference for either of the colors based on the clearer and more distinct appearance of the letters and numbers. This assessment involved the determination of red or green characters more sharply while the person sees it.

  • Interpretation: The results are based on the color preferences.

    1. Emmetropia: If the patients express no preferences for both colors, it indicates that they are focusing light on the retina, which means they have normal vision or emmetropia.

    2. Myopia (Nearsightedness): If the patients express that the green characters appear clearer than the red characters, it indicates myopia, which means they focus light in front of the retina. These patients require concave corrective lenses or glasses.

    3. Hyperopia (Farsightedness): If the patients express that the red characters appear clearer than the green characters, it indicates hyperopia, which means they focus light behind the retina. These patients require convex corrective lenses or glasses.

What Are the Advantages of Duochrome Tests?

Various advantages of the duochrome test include

  • Simple and Quick: This test is a straightforward and faster procedure that acts as a time-efficient tool for ophthalmologists.

  • Engagement of Patients: The subjective type of procedure that involves an individual's preference for one color over another will actively engage the individuals in the assessment process. This helps in a more informative and collaborative examination of the eye.

  • Refraction Guidance: Though it is not a standalone diagnostic procedure, this test gives initial guidance to the refractive errors of the eye, which mainly helps the patients determine whether to get a concave lens or a convex lens.

  • Cost-Effective: The duochrome test is a cost-effective procedure due to its simplicity for the initial identification of the vision.

  • Comparability With Standard Charts: The duochrome test can be interrelated with Snellen charts, a standard eye chart that makes routine eye examination easier.

  • Early Detection of Refractive Errors: This test possesses an early detection of refractive errors by quick identification. This helps in early vision correction and betterment of eye health.

  • Initial Screening: The duochrome test serves as an early screening tool that helps eye care professionals determine the necessity of future examinations.

What Are the Limitations of the Duochrome Test?

The duochrome test possesses certain limitations, which include

  • Subjectivity: The duochrome test mainly depends on the subjective judgment of the patients being tested. Some factors may influence the result, including lighting conditions, individual preferences, and personal perception.

  • Limited to Spherical Refractive Errors: The duochrome test particularly addresses spherical refractive errors like hyperopia and myopia. This test may not provide detailed information about astigmatism (irregularities in the shape of the lens or cornea).

  • No Replacement in Comprehensive Eye Examinations: Though the duochrome test is a valuable diagnostic tool, it should not change the comprehensive eye examination. Thus, additional testing is required for other aspects of visual health, such as depth perception, eye coordination, and other eye health conditions.

  • Accommodation Influence: The ability of the eye to adjust the focus is said to be accommodation. Accommodation can affect the results interpreted by the duochrome test. The test may not accurately reflect the person's refractive error if accommodation is not appropriately controlled.

  • Not for All Ages: Mostly young children and individuals with difficulty in expressing their color preferences may find this test difficult. In such cases, alternative tests and methods may be more useful.

  • Limited Diagnosis: The duochrome test may be used only to identify potential refractive errors and visual acuity, which guides the correction of refractive errors. It may not help diagnose other eye conditions like retinal disorders or glaucoma.

  • Depend on Correct Perception: The accuracy of the duochrome test mainly depends on the individual's last corrective prescription, which means if the individual was already wearing the corrective lenses and glasses, the duochrome might not accurately show the uncorrected visual acuity.

Conclusion

The Duochrome test stands as a valuable tool in the optometrist's arsenal, offering a quick and engaging means of assessing visual acuity and identifying potential refractive errors. While not a comprehensive diagnostic tool on its own, when combined with other assessments, it contributes to a more thorough understanding of an individual's visual needs. Regular eye examinations, including tests like the Duochrome test, play a crucial role in maintaining eye health and ensuring optimal vision.
